Wayne Kirby Doing Well Following Prostate Cancer Surgery

Mets first base coach Wayne Kirby underwent surgery to deal with prostate cancer on Tuesday. Kirby found out about the cancer prior to the season and his condition was unknown until during the #StandUp2Cancer moment at the All Star Game when Mets first baseman Pete Alonso and Padres third baseman Manny Machado each wrote Kirby’s names down on their cards. #Mets Pete Alonso and #Padres Manny...

Mets 2022 Draft Class Receiving Rave Reviews

The Mets went into Sunday knowing they had one of the more important drafts in recent team history on their hand with five picks in the first 90 and 22 selections overall. I believe most would say that the Mets continued to draft well including Keith Law of The Athletic that had all four of the Mets’ early selections in his top 50 draft-eligible prospects.
